Instructions to make Moong dal dosa:

  1. Wash and soak moong dal overnight.
  2. Drain all the water. Grind it into smooth paste by adding salt and little water..
  3. Heat a pan with oil. Sauté all the ingredients under sauté section for just 2 mins..
  4. Add this to the ground batter and mix it well..
  5. Heat dosa pan. Pour the batter and spread it into round shape. Sprinkle oil. Flip it and cook both sides..
  6. Serve with any chutney or it can be eaten as it is. I like to eat as it is without any chutney..
